Conquering the White Film: Your Ultimate Guide to Sparkling Pots and Pans

That pesky white film stubbornly clinging to the bottom of your pots and pans? It’s most likely mineral buildup, primarily calcium and magnesium, from your water. Luckily, it’s usually harmless and relatively easy to remove with the right approach, saving you from premature cookware retirement.

Understanding the Enemy: What is This White Film, Really?

The white film plaguing your cookware isn’t a sign of poor hygiene, but rather a consequence of hard water. Hard water contains a high concentration of minerals like calcium carbonate, magnesium carbonate, and sometimes silica. When water evaporates during cooking or washing, these minerals are left behind, adhering to the surface of your pots and pans. Over time, this accumulation creates a noticeable white or cloudy residue. This buildup is particularly common in regions with high mineral content in the water supply. The heat involved in cooking accelerates the deposition process, making the problem more noticeable over time.

Battle Strategies: Proven Methods for White Film Removal

Now, let’s delve into the most effective techniques for banishing that unsightly white film. Remember to always test a small, inconspicuous area first, especially on delicate cookware.

The Vinegar Soak: A Simple Yet Effective Solution

This method is ideal for mild to moderate buildup.

  1. Fill the pot with a solution of equal parts white vinegar and water.
  2. Bring the solution to a simmer on the stovetop.
  3. Let it simmer for 15-30 minutes, keeping a close eye to prevent the solution from boiling dry.
  4. Remove from heat and let it cool slightly.
  5. Use a non-abrasive sponge or cloth to scrub away the loosened mineral deposits.
  6. Rinse thoroughly with warm, soapy water.
  7. Dry completely with a microfiber cloth.

Pro Tip: For particularly stubborn buildup, you can let the vinegar solution soak overnight.

The Baking Soda Boost: For Extra Cleaning Power

When vinegar alone isn’t enough, baking soda provides an extra layer of abrasion.

  1. After the vinegar soak (or if you prefer to start with baking soda), sprinkle a generous amount of baking soda onto the affected areas.
  2. Add a small amount of water to create a paste.
  3. Gently scrub the paste onto the white film using a non-abrasive sponge or cloth.
  4. Rinse thoroughly with warm, soapy water.
  5. Dry completely with a microfiber cloth.

Caution: While baking soda is generally considered a mild abrasive, avoid excessive scrubbing, which can still scratch some cookware surfaces.

Prevention is Key: Stopping White Film Before it Starts

While removing white film is achievable, preventing its buildup in the first place is even better. Here’s how:

  • Dry your cookware thoroughly after washing: Don’t let water sit and evaporate, leaving behind mineral deposits.
  • Consider using filtered water: A water filter can significantly reduce the mineral content of your water.
  • Use a water softener: If you live in an area with very hard water, a water softener can be a worthwhile investment.
  • Regularly clean your cookware: Don’t wait for significant buildup before cleaning. A quick wipe-down with a vinegar solution after each use can go a long way.

FAQs: Your Burning Questions Answered

Here are some common questions people have about removing white film from pots and pans:

FAQ 1: Can I use steel wool or abrasive scrub pads?

Answer: Absolutely not! Abrasive materials like steel wool and harsh scrub pads will scratch the surface of your cookware, potentially damaging it permanently and making it more susceptible to future buildup. Always use non-abrasive sponges or cloths.

FAQ 2: Is the white film harmful if ingested?

Answer: While the appearance might be concerning, the mineral buildup itself is generally considered harmless if ingested in small amounts. It’s primarily composed of calcium and magnesium, which are essential minerals. However, you should still remove it for aesthetic reasons and to maintain the performance of your cookware.

FAQ 3: Will these methods work on all types of cookware?

Answer: These methods are generally safe for stainless steel, glass, and enamel-coated cookware. However, proceed with caution on delicate materials like non-stick surfaces. Always test a small, inconspicuous area first to ensure the cleaning solution doesn’t damage the coating.

FAQ 4: How often should I clean my pots and pans to prevent white film buildup?

Answer: The frequency depends on the hardness of your water and how often you use your cookware. A quick wipe-down with a vinegar solution after each use can significantly reduce buildup. A more thorough cleaning every few weeks should be sufficient in most cases.

FAQ 5: Can I use a dishwasher to prevent white film?

Answer: Dishwashers can actually contribute to white film buildup, especially if you have hard water. The high heat and extended exposure to water can accelerate mineral deposition. If you do use a dishwasher, consider adding a rinse aid designed to combat hard water stains.

FAQ 6: What if the white film is extremely stubborn and doesn’t come off with these methods?

Answer: For extremely stubborn buildup, you might need to repeat the cleaning process multiple times. Alternatively, you can try a commercially available descaling solution specifically designed for cookware. Always follow the manufacturer’s instructions carefully.

FAQ 7: Can I use CLR or other heavy-duty cleaning products?

Answer: While CLR and similar products can be effective for removing mineral deposits, they are generally not recommended for cookware due to their harsh chemicals. They can damage the surface and leave behind residues that are difficult to remove. Stick to gentler, food-safe options like vinegar and baking soda.

FAQ 8: Does the type of water I use affect the white film buildup?

Answer: Absolutely. Hard water, which contains high levels of calcium and magnesium, is the primary culprit behind white film buildup. Using filtered water or a water softener can significantly reduce the problem.

FAQ 9: My non-stick pan has white film. What should I do?

Answer: Be extremely cautious when cleaning non-stick cookware. Avoid abrasive cleaners and scrubbing pads. A gentle wipe-down with a vinegar and water solution or a baking soda paste is usually sufficient. If the buildup is severe, consider replacing the pan, as the non-stick coating may be compromised.

FAQ 10: Is boiling the pot in vinegar and water necessary, or can I just soak it?

Answer: Boiling helps loosen the mineral deposits more effectively, but soaking can be sufficient for mild buildup. If you choose to soak, allow it to soak for a longer period, ideally overnight.

FAQ 11: Can I use these methods on my glass stovetop?

Answer: While vinegar and baking soda are generally safe for glass stovetops, avoid abrasive scrub pads, which can scratch the surface. A paste of baking soda and water, gently rubbed onto the surface, can effectively remove mineral deposits and food residue.

FAQ 12: How do I know if my water is hard?

Answer: You can often tell if you have hard water by noticing signs like white film on your dishes and cookware, difficulty lathering soap, and mineral deposits around faucets and showerheads. You can also purchase a water hardness testing kit or contact your local water utility for information about the water hardness in your area.
